College Prowler Take
Despite Claremont’s academic reputation and sometimes ambitious workload, what sets it apart from similar schools is the outgoing nature of its student body. CMCers like to get out and meet people, whether it’s at a party, a concert, a movie, or any other social event. That means tons of chances to meet the one—or just someone, depending on who you’re looking for. CMCers dabble in both the one-night stand and the long-term commitment. Most people are single, which means meeting a random stranger at a party isn’t abnormal. On the flipside, while CMCers don’t marry as a rule, it happens often enough not to seem unusual. The five colleges in the Claremont consortium provide a deep pool of all different types of people with hugely varied interests, so there isn’t just one type who can find love or lovin’, and you’ll never run the risk of meeting everyone if you look around. One thing you won’t find at CMC is the Girls Gone Wild film crew prowling the parties. CMC guys and girls don’t do much public nudity, and parties don’t usually center on sex as much as other types of debauchery (although you might get lucky on Mardi Gras weekend). Most RAs keep a stock of condoms for those who didn’t plan ahead (and earplugs for their neighbors). The Health Education Outreach, located in the health center, also provides free condoms and other contraceptives, in addition to a wealth of information on everything you should know about safe hookups, and for gosh sakes, people, if you’re gonna do it, do it safe!

Social Scene
Claremont has a very active social scene, based mostly on campus. Campus parties are put on by the Student Government, and alcohol is relatively free-flowing. Parties range in size from small dorm get-togethers to school-wide parties to Five College parties. Not everyone parties, but you'll find mostly empty rooms on weekends since the student body is really outgoing and there are a lot of alternatives to the typical party like club events and IM sports.
Hookups or Relationships?
There is a pretty even balance between people in some sort of serious relationship and people out looking for booty at parties and such. Random hookups are common, and although not everyone will know your business, do remember that it can be a very small community at times.
Best Places to Meet Guys/Girls
Parties on campus are the main vehicle for love, and loose keg taps provide a social lubricant for a lot of people. But parties usually have a theme, and major points go to the most creative or funny, rather than those who can drink the most. There’s nothing sexy about a sloppy drunk. Most weekends, there are Five College parties, which are big and are definitely the best place for a promiscuous chance encounter. Claremont throws good parties, although quantity is more our forte, while Harvey Mudd throws the wildest bashes. Scripps (the all-girls school) is always a good place to find girls, and any of the colleges can be hunting ground for guys (although Mudders sometimes have a reputation for social ineptness). For anyone not looking for the magical moment that is a drunken hookup, the sky is the limit on good places to meet people. A lot of CMCers would label the brain as the sexiest organ, so it’s not completely unheard of to meet people in class, or, more likely, at a club event. Mudd hosts the Occasional Ball from time to time, which is a dry party with free ballroom dancing lessons, which are fun.
Dress Code
Dress is really relaxed, with flip-flops the only uniform. CMCers are pretty typical college kids wearing clothes ranging from good thrift store pick-ups to the prep-lite styles of Abercrombie, Hollister, and J.Crew. Since so many people play sports, athletic wear is common, too. At parties, people often dress for the theme, such as Smilin' 80s. CMC dresses more conservatively than most of the consortium, but around the 5Cs it's not out of the question to see guys in kilts and anything else you can think of.
